Top Features to Look for in Insurance Software for Small Businesses

Navigating the world of insurance software can be challenging for small businesses. With various options and functionalities, it’s crucial to identify the top features that will not only streamline your operations but also ensure compliance and improve customer satisfaction. 

Here’s a comprehensive guide to the essential features you should look for when choosing insurance software for your small business.

User-Friendly Interface

A user-friendly interface is critical for any software, but it’s especially important for insurance software where staff efficiency can directly impact client satisfaction. 

Look for intuitive designs and easy navigation that reduce the learning curve for your employees.

Comprehensive Policy Management

Effective policy management is the backbone of any insurance business. Your software should provide comprehensive tools to manage various types of policies, automate renewals, and track policy status in real-time.

Claims Processing Automation

Automated claims processing helps reduce errors, expedite claims, and improve customer satisfaction. 

Look for software that offers end-to-end claims management with features like claim submission, evaluation, tracking, and resolution.

Integration Capabilities

In today’s interconnected business environment, integration capabilities are crucial. 

Ensure that the insurance software can integrate seamlessly with other systems you use, such as customer relationship management (CRM) software, accounting systems, or even donation tracking software if applicable.

Customizability and Scalability

As your business grows, your software should grow with you. Choose an insurance software development company that offers customizable solutions tailored to your specific needs. 

Additionally, ensure the software is scalable to handle increasing data volumes and user counts.

Data Security and Compliance

Data security is non-negotiable in the insurance industry. The software must comply with industry regulations and standards, such as GDPR or HIPAA, to protect sensitive client information.

Analytics and Reporting

Analytics and reporting tools provide valuable insights into your business operations. 

Look for software that offers customizable reporting, real-time analytics, and dashboards that help you track performance, identify trends, and make data-driven decisions.

Customer Portal

A customer portal enhances client engagement by allowing policyholders to access their information, submit claims, and communicate with your company online. 

This feature not only improves customer satisfaction but also reduces the workload on your staff.

Vendor Support and Training

Finally, reliable vendor support and comprehensive training are essential for successful software implementation and use. 

Choose an insurance software provider that offers ongoing support, regular updates, and thorough training for your team.
